New debates on child tax credits
The Ministry of Finance (MF) is planning a change in the amount of the child tax credit, but as a permanent measure to take effect from 2027. This was stated by Finance Minister Galab Donev during a meeting of the budget committee.
"The Ministry of Finance is considering a change in the amount of the tax credit in the form of a permanent measure, aligned with the parameters of the 2027 Budget," Donev emphasized.
Why were the proposals rejected?
- Administrative burden: According to the MF, a change in the middle of the year would burden employers, as the credit is already being used in advance.
- Budgetary predictability: The department insists on a broad public discussion and coordination with the parameters for the next budget cycle.
The proposals by "We Continue the Change" for a double increase and by GERB-SDS for a 60% growth were not accepted by the committee. Asen Vasilev defended the idea, pointing out that the state has the resources due to the higher GDP, but the Ministry of Finance remains skeptical about hasty changes between the first and second reading.
